## Local Setup

Northgale's build now runs under the Permafrost hermetic toolchain. Do not install system compilers; everything is pinned in the manifest. Run `pf sync` then `pf build //...`. Network access is blocked during builds except the artifact cache. Integration tests still need the shared fixtures database, so export the connection string shown here before running them.

replica DSN, tawef-hahap: mysql://eliix_svc:FiIC0jz@db-394a.lumiclabs.internal:5432/holius

The Fareloom rules engine evaluates shipping-fee rules in priority order, stopping at the first rule whose conditions fully match the shipment payload. New team members should note that rules are versioned: edits never mutate a live rule, they create a draft that must be promoted explicitly. Every request to the evaluation endpoint must be authenticated against the internal Fareloom gateway, and the key used for that authentication appears directly below.

API key for yahig-tadup: kto7_ubizbYm

Action item from the Keyvault-Rotator incident (Fernwick deploy). The utility retried rotation against the stale replica for 40 minutes because backoff and lease-TTL values were hardcoded in three places. Consolidate them into one config module, add a startup assertion that lease TTL exceeds max retry window, and log the effective values at boot. Do not ship new defaults without a dry-run against the staging vault. Until the refactor lands, treat the following as the single source of truth. The current constants are:

limits module of tafof-kagef:
RATE_LIMITS = {
    "zorix": 10,
    "ralath": 1,
    "quenwyn": 2,
    "holael": 10,
}

## Changelog — Ticktrace 1.9

### Renamed: DRIFT_API_TOKEN
During the cron drift investigation we found plugins confusing this variable with the metrics token, so it has been renamed to indicate it authorizes drift-report uploads specifically. Plugin authors must read the new name from 1.9 onward; the old name is ignored without warning. Sample env files in the SDK are updated. In your deployment env file, the drift-report upload secret is set on the next line.

env line for fawef-taguf: VAULT_KEY13=a9695905a9a90